| Materials | Stainless 201/304/304L/316/316L, aluminum, black wire (carbon steel), brass; optional gold/brass plating |
| Manufacturing | Slit-and-stretch expanded metal; also available as pre-crimped architectural mesh (two-way separated wave bending, locked bending, flat-topped curved) |
| LWD × SWD | ≈ 6×3 mm up to 75×30 mm (real-world use may vary by pattern) |
| Strand width / thickness | ≈ 1–6 mm / 0.5–5 mm |
| Open area | ≈ 25–70% |
| Finishes | Mill, anodized (Al), powder coat, PVD, plating; custom RAL |
| Panel size | Up to ≈ 1500 × 3000 mm typical; custom by request |
decorative expanded metal usually goes like this: coil selection → slitting → expanding or pre-crimp weaving → flattening (optional) → cutting → deburring → surface finish → QC → packing (plastic film, then pallets). For coastal projects, I keep pushing 316L + powder over conversion coat, tested to ASTM B117 salt spray. Typical life: around 10–25 years outdoors depending on environment and finish; inland interiors go much longer.

Ask for mockups: orientation (diamond long-way vs short-way), edge trims, and mounting clips. For coastal jobs, I’d choose 316L + super-durable polyester powder (AAMA 2605-grade resins where possible). For aluminum, stick to ≥AA15 anodizing if abrasion is a concern.
A retail rollout in humid Southeast Asia picked 304 SS, flat-topped curved pattern, black powder at ≈ 60 μm. They wanted drama without glare; the result looked “tailored” yet tough. They reported fewer touch-ups after six months than their perforated panels—small win, but it adds up across 30 stores.
